Osloposten (The Oslo Gazette) was a free newspaper published in Oslo, Norway from 1997 to 2002.

The paper was published by the Danish newspaper company Søndagsavisen AS in Oslo via its subsidiary Norsk Avisdrift.[1] The paper was launched in 1997 and was distributed in 234,000 copies before it was discontinued in 2002.[2][3] The paper failed to succeed against its competitor, Avis 1,[2] which was established by Schibsted in order to protect Schibsted's share of Oslo's advertising market.[4] Avis 1 was discontinued in 2005.[4]
